Since Indonesia’s independence day until today, there are 10 curriculum that have been implemented in the national education system of Indonesia. From 1974 until 2013, the government have changed the curriculum for almost 11 times—in 1947, 1952, 1964, 1968, 1975, 1984, 1994, 1999, 2004, 2006 and 2013. The changes that occur is a manifestation of the consequences of changes in the era such as changes in economic, political, social, cultural as well as science and technology evolve. Compulsory education lasts for 12 years, which covers a 6-year primary school program, a 3-year junior secondary school program, and a 3-year senior secondary program. Overview of the education system (EAG 2020) On average, 44% of all upper secondary students enrol in VET programmes in Indonesia, a higher proportion than the OECD average of 42%. In Indonesia, there are two types of Muslim schools, that is boarding schools known as “pesantren” and Islamic day schools known as madrassahs (or madrasas). Pesantren began as an informal religious school meanwhile madrassahs by offering a more formalized religious education but as time goes by sometimes, the situation can be reversed. They can choose between state-run, nonsectarian public schools supervised by the Ministry of National Education (Kemdiknas) or private or semi-private religious (usually Islamic) schools supervised and financed by the Ministry of Religious Affairs.
